Reading bytes from a JavaScript blob received by WebSocket
html, javascript, performance
Solution
Have you considered:
socket.binaryType = 'arraybuffer';
The function becomes:
function convert(data) {
return new Uint8Array(data);
}
Which will not actually have to do any work because it's just a view on the buffer.
Problem
I have a WebSocket that receives binary messages and I want iterate over the bytes. I came up with the following conversion function... ``` // Convert the buffer to a byte array. function convert(data, cb) { // Initialize a new instance of the FileReader class. var fileReader = new FileReader(); // Called when the read operation is successfully completed. fileReader.onload = function () { // Invoke the callback. cb(new Uint8Array(this.result)); }; // Starts reading the contents of the specified blob. fileReader.readAsArrayBuffer(data); } ``` This does work, but the performance is terrible. Is there a better way to allow reading bytes?
